问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

如何保存HTML的多个页面

创作时间:
作者:
@小白创作中心

如何保存HTML的多个页面

引用
1
来源
1.
https://docs.pingcode.com/baike/3005321

保存HTML的多个页面可以通过以下方法:使用文件系统、使用版本控制系统、使用项目管理工具、使用网页抓取工具。其中,使用版本控制系统是较为有效和专业的方法,因为它不仅可以保存多个HTML页面,还能跟踪页面的更改历史,协同团队开发,并提供强大的分支和合并功能。

一、使用文件系统

1. 创建文件夹结构

在文件系统中保存HTML页面时,首先需要创建一个合理的文件夹结构。每个HTML页面可以放在一个单独的文件夹中,所有文件夹都可以放在一个主目录下。这样可以保证文件的有序性和易于查找。

project-directory/
├── index.html
├── page1/
│   ├── index.html
│   ├── style.css
│   └── script.js
├── page2/
│   ├── index.html
│   ├── style.css
│   └── script.js
└── assets/
    ├── images/
    ├── css/
    └── js/

2. 使用相对路径

在HTML文件中引用CSS、JavaScript和图片等资源时,使用相对路径可以确保在不同的环境下都能正确加载这些资源。例如:

<link rel="stylesheet" href="../assets/css/style.css">
<script src="../assets/js/script.js"></script>

二、使用版本控制系统

1. 初始化Git仓库

在项目目录中初始化一个Git仓库,可以使用以下命令:

git init

2. 创建分支

创建不同的分支来保存不同的HTML页面或版本。例如,可以创建一个分支保存首页,一个分支保存产品页面:

git checkout -b homepage
git add index.html
git commit -m "Add homepage"
git checkout -b product-page
git add product.html
git commit -m "Add product page"

3. 合并分支

在需要合并不同页面或版本时,可以使用以下命令:

git checkout main
git merge homepage
git merge product-page

4. 使用远程仓库

将本地仓库推送到远程仓库(如GitHub、GitLab),这样可以方便团队协作,并在任何地方访问:

git remote add origin https://github.com/user/repo.git
git push -u origin main

三、使用项目管理工具

使用研发项目管理系统PingCode和通用项目协作软件Worktile可以高效管理HTML页面。PingCode适用于研发项目管理,提供了强大的需求管理、任务分配和进度跟踪功能;而Worktile则适用于通用项目协作,拥有任务管理、团队沟通和文档管理等功能。

2. 创建项目和任务

在PingCode或Worktile中创建一个新项目,并为每个HTML页面创建任务。任务可以包含页面的详细说明、设计图和开发规范等。

3. 文件管理

这些工具通常提供文件管理功能,可以直接上传HTML文件及其相关资源,并通过任务关联这些文件。

4. 协同工作

团队成员可以在任务下进行讨论,上传新的文件版本,分配和跟踪任务进度,确保所有HTML页面的开发和维护有条不紊。

四、使用网页抓取工具

1. 使用抓取工具保存页面

使用如HTTrack、SiteSucker等网页抓取工具,可以将整个网站或多个HTML页面保存到本地。只需要输入网址,工具会自动下载所有页面及其资源。

2. 定时抓取和更新

可以设置抓取工具定时运行,自动检查和更新本地保存的HTML页面,确保与在线版本同步。

3. 管理抓取的文件

将抓取到的HTML页面按日期或版本号进行归档,便于后续查找和对比。

五、总结

保存HTML的多个页面可以通过多种方法实现,每种方法都有其优点和适用场景。使用文件系统适合个人或小型项目;使用版本控制系统则适合团队协作和版本管理;使用项目管理工具可以提供更全面的项目管理和协作功能;使用网页抓取工具则适合保存和备份现有网站。根据实际需求选择合适的方法,可以更高效地管理和保存HTML页面。

相关问答FAQs:

1. 如何保存多个HTML页面?

  • 问题:我想保存多个HTML页面,该怎么做?

  • 回答:您可以使用以下方法保存多个HTML页面:

    • 将每个页面的内容复制到一个文本编辑器中,然后将文件保存为.html格式。

    • 使用网页抓取工具,如HTTrack,来下载整个网站的多个页面并保存为本地文件。

    • 使用浏览器的"保存网页"功能,将每个页面逐个保存为HTML文件。

    • 如果您熟悉编程,可以使用Python等编程语言编写脚本来批量保存HTML页面。

2. 如何将多个HTML页面保存为一个文件?

  • 问题:我想将多个HTML页面保存为一个文件,有没有简便的方法?

  • 回答:是的,您可以使用以下方法将多个HTML页面保存为一个文件:

    • 创建一个新的HTML页面,使用<iframe>标签嵌入每个页面。

    • 使用浏览器的打印功能,将每个页面逐个打印为PDF文件,然后将这些PDF文件合并成一个文件。

    • 使用在线工具或软件将多个HTML文件合并为一个文件。

    • 如果您熟悉编程,可以使用Python等编程语言编写脚本来自动合并HTML文件。

3. 如何将多个HTML页面保存为一个可浏览的文件夹?

  • 问题:我想将多个HTML页面保存为一个可以在浏览器中浏览的文件夹,该怎么做?

  • 回答:您可以使用以下方法将多个HTML页面保存为一个可浏览的文件夹:

    • 创建一个新的文件夹,并在其中保存每个HTML页面的文件。

    • 创建一个主页(通常是index.html),在该页面中添加导航链接指向其他页面。

    • 确保每个HTML页面中的链接路径正确指向其他页面。

    • 打开主页(index.html)文件,浏览器将自动加载其他页面,并且您可以通过导航链接在这个文件夹中浏览页面。

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号